Regardless how you feel about poros typically, you can’t deny this wallpaper its merit. You might have noticed Riot Kayle flying after them in the background. What you might not have noticed is Riot Blitzcrank and Riot Graves hanging out the windows of the two cars giving chase. The theme of the Riot skins is that they are police, so this makes sense. The smoke has cleared from the League of Legends Mid-Season Cup, which saw China's top talent square off against Korea's finest in place of the canceled MSI.
